The Stewardship Mapping and Assessment Project (STEW-MAP) survey has cataloged and mapped environmental stewardship groups in dozens of cities within the US and worldwide. The survey collects relational, network ties among respondents and their collaborators. In this study, we focus on the 2019 Baltimore, Maryland survey to better understand the relationships among environmental stewardship organizations across the city. We utilize exponential random graph models (ERGMs) to explore the factors that predict the formation of three distinct types of ties: collaboration, resource sharing, and knowledge sharing. The networks include 1,201 nodes with 2,884 total ties among them. Our results show that the network structure of each tie type is unique, but there is a shared tendency for degree distributions to be positively skewed, indicating the presence of many lower degree nodes. We also find that the main focus of these organizations and the organization type create substantial variation in their behavior; with some groups siloed, and others underutilized, one set of groups has managed to permeate all three networks: stormwater-focused groups. This study is the first to analyze this specific dataset and one of the few to use network models to analyze data collected through the STEW-MAP project. This work helps us understand the social forces shaping Baltimore’s stewardship network, while pointing to ways in which practitioners could potentially expand their reach. This approach is a complement to the definition of inclusion as a social-psychological response to experiences in a diverse social environment. We analyze networks of interaction over time in a large population of students and evaluate the extent to which two interventions—working in teams and using a social networking service (SNS)—grew and diversified their social capital. Using network data collected before and after 518 undergraduate students worked in 96 teams and participated in the SNS, we analyze the formation of new bridging social capital (ties between demographically dissimilar people) and new bonding social capital (ties between demographically similar people). Team membership had a large effect on social capital, creating positive bonding ties and bridging ties. But teams also created negative ties. The SNS facilitated tie formation but did not create negative ties. Together, the two interventions expanded networks and shifted the balance of ties in favor of bridging ties, producing a more structurally inclusive network. The first represents tie changes based on agency for both node sets. The second is a model for selection and influence in co-evolution of two two-mode networks, where the first is a membership network which serves to represent connections between groups making choices of activities in the second network. The third consists of new effects for categorical nodal covariates, representing the heterogeneity between nodes that often occurs in two-mode networks. As an illustration, selection and influence processes are studied in the co-evolution of the director interlock network of a set of 141 large European companies and the two-mode network of environmental policies of these companies, for the period from 2018 to 2022. Similarity between environmental policies is expressed in two ways: endorsing the same policy items, and correlation between the number of items endorsed. However, existing ARD models face two key limitations. First, they mask heterogeneity in network sizes across individuals who may differ markedly in relevant characteristics despite exhibiting similar response patterns on the ARD instrument. Second, although existing models can measure the overall level of segregation in contact with groups, they cannot reveal the determinants of segregation. To address these limitations, we introduce the Covariate Model, a regression-based framework that incorporates respondent covariates into analyses of ARD. We illustrate this model using ARD on contact with occupational categories. In addition to obtaining more substantively plausible network size estimates than existing approaches, the Covariate Model uncovers novel segregation patterns. For example, covariates — driven primarily by educational differences — account for a considerable portion of the segregation in contact with Higher Service occupations (e.g., lawyers and professors) but contribute little to explaining barriers to interaction with other occupational classes. This study examines how informant perspectives differ using network data obtained from 438 fifth-grade students (<em>M</em><sub>age</sub> = 11.19 years old, 46 % girls) in 13 Indonesian elementary school classrooms. Using a cross-informant framework, we investigated how self- and peer-reported bully-victim relationships overlapped as a function of the sex of bullies and victims, friendship ties, and relational schemas (i.e., mental network heuristics). Results from a multiplex exponential random graph model revealed significant agreement between self- and peer-reports. There was greater agreement when bully-victim relationships occurred between non-friends. When self- and peer-reports disagreed, peers identified more instances of boys engaging in bullying than girls, as well as more cross-sex than same-sex bully-victim relationships. Self-reports more often identified bully-victim relationships between friends than between non-friends. Post-hoc analyses revealed that bullies and their friends often had conflicting views of their friendship. Additionally, peers reported more victims per bully and fewer bullies per victim when compared to self-reports. In this approach, the number of people respondents report knowing in subpopulations of known size are scaled-up to estimate the size of their personal network. Because this method is sensitive to reporting errors, researchers often top-code responses about subpopulations of known size, although there is no consensus on how to select the top-code value. Here, we compare several top-coding methods, including new approaches that utilize Dunbar’s number, using datasets collected from two aggregated relational data surveys, one from Shanghai and one from Kambia, Sierra Leone. We employ three metrics to evaluate the top-coding strategies: mean error rates in the estimation of the subpopulations of known size, error rate in estimation of the target population, and degree mean. We find that the top-coding strategies all perform equally well in the estimation of the subpopulations of known size in both datasets. The strategies based on Dunbar’s number, however, performed better than the other strategies in the estimation of the target population in Kambia. In addition, the Dunbar’s number approaches produced substantially smaller degree means in both datasets. We examine these findings wholistically and provide suggestions for how researchers should approach top-coding decisions. Data come from the police operation denoted “Perseo”, which led to the arrest of 99 individuals active in the period 2006–2008. Specifically, we focus on the effect of hierarchical structure, task specialization patterns, and geographical organization on the probability of tie formation by estimating dyadic regressions. We find: First, if both agents in a dyad are bosses, two effects of opposite sign are at work: a scale effect, that increases the probability, and a homophily effect, that decreases such probability. Second, organizational task homophily positively affects tie formation, while criminal task homophily does not. Third, the key geographical variable driving tie formation is joint membership to the same <em>mandamento</em>, which makes sheer geographical distance non-statistically significant.
